Prediksi Hasil Tanaman Padi Menggunakan Random Forest dengan Seleksi Fitur Berbasis Feature Importance dan Optimasi Hyperparameter GridSearchCV

Rice production in Indonesia fluctuates due to agronomic, spatial, and climatic factors. This study develops a rice production validation model using Random Forest Regressor with feature importance-based feature selection and GridSearchCV hyperparameter optimization. Agricultural data from BPS for 2018-2024 were combined with annual NASA POWER weather data from 37 provinces in Indonesia. The model predicts rice productivity and converts the prediction into production using actual harvested area. Feature selection reduced 32 initial predictors to 16 final features. The optimized model achieved production R² of 99.79%, adjusted R² of 99.73%, RMSE of 115,600.28 tons, MAE of 61,194.75 tons, MAPE of 6.95%, and SMAPE of 6.86%. It is important to note that the high production R² of 99.79% is substantially driven by the mathematical dominance of actual harvested area as a multiplier in the production conversion formula, rather than solely reflecting the predictive power of the climate model. The core predictive performance of the model at the productivity level (R² = 75.45%, MAPE = 6.95%) more accurately represents the model’s generalization capability. Research limitations include limited historical data for newly established provinces in Papua and the relatively short study period of 2018-2024. These results indicate that the proposed method provides accurate validation for rice production analysis.
